Afsaneh_A, Jun 2026
Great value for the cost
Gaztelugatxe is a very intense physical experience - over 200 steps up to the top and back and that's not even the hardest part. There's a long and very steep climb back up to the parking area. Bermeo wasn't very exciting. Had an excellent sea bass lunch at the Casino in Mundanka, a very interesting (and too short) visit to Gernika and ended the tour with a Txakoli tasting at a winery. The day trip was well worth the money.

Poised just a few miles inland from the Basque Country coast—and within easy driving distance of southwestern France—Bilbao is a convenient jumping-off point for travelers looking to explore more of the region. Depending on your interests, Bilbao day trips can take you to Basque hubs such as San Sebastián or La Rioja, Spain's best-known wine region. Alternatively, head across the French border to enviable resort towns such as Biarritz. And for intrepid types, the Picos de Europa mountains beckon.
